Monday, April 4, 1983

Watford recorded an emphatic victory over local rivals Luton Town at Vicarage Road, their first triumph in the derby fixture for more than a decade.

The Hornets came into the game on the back of a relatively poor run of three defeats in four games and were 2-1 down at one stage after Luther Blissett had provided an early lead.

Richard Jobson scored a fine equaliser shortly before half-time however, and the visitors were blown away by a second-half performance that saw further goals from Blissett, John Barnes and Nigel Callaghan cement a 5-2 victory.

The result left the visitors in severe relegation trouble.
